Transaction 5c538326c1e23f70383a4aa3964ac35841e078c5b365f3115a62e4f24eb1f0ce
1 Input
1 Output
-
5c538326c1e23f70383a4aa3964ac35841e078c5b365f3115a62e4f24eb1f0ce:0
- value
- 764514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1d73838ec3b2830144f0afa56cc9a7333fe8ed1 OP_EQUAL
- address
- 3PjkbVjGUBCzA4LPBqoswQJDBdUicykVdM